为什么Excel加载项出不来
124人看过
加载项管理器中的隐藏状态
许多用户可能未曾注意到,Excel的加载项管理界面中存在"活动"与"非活动"两种状态。当加载项被意外设置为非活动时,即便安装成功也不会在功能区显示。此时可通过文件菜单进入选项设置,在加载项分类底部找到"管理"下拉菜单,选择"Excel加载项"后点击"执行"按钮,在弹出窗口中勾选目标加载项名称。需特别注意,部分加载项需要重启Excel才能完全激活。
安全策略对加载项的拦截机制现代Excel版本内置了多层安全防护体系,当检测到加载项来源不可信或含有宏代码时,会自动禁用相关功能。这种情况在从网络下载或第三方获取的加载项中尤为常见。用户可通过信任中心设置,将包含加载项的文件夹添加到受信任位置列表。对于数字签名缺失的加载项,还需在宏设置中选择"启用所有宏"选项,但此举会降低安全性等级,建议仅在可控环境下使用。
文件路径权限的访问限制系统权限配置不当会导致Excel无法读取加载项文件。特别是当文件存储在系统保护目录或网络共享位置时,可能因用户账户控制策略而受阻。此时应检查文件属性中的安全选项卡,确保当前用户具有完全控制权限。对于企业环境下的用户,还需确认组策略未禁止执行脚本类文件。将加载项移至用户文档目录并重新注册,往往能解决此类权限问题。
版本兼容性导致的冲突不同Excel版本对加载项的兼容要求存在显著差异。为旧版开发的加载项可能无法在新版中正常运行,反之亦然。例如使用动态链接库开发的加载项,若依赖特定版本的运行时库文件,在未安装对应环境的电脑上就会失效。解决方法是查阅加载项文档中的系统要求,必要时联系开发者获取兼容版本。对于Office 365用户,可尝试切换更新通道来匹配加载项的支持范围。
注册表项损坏的影响Windows注册表中存储着Excel加载项的配置信息,当这些注册表项出现损坏或丢失时,即便文件完好也无法加载。这种情况常见于非正常卸载后的残留条目,或系统还原操作造成的版本错乱。通过运行注册表编辑器,依次展开特定路径下的Excel加载项分支,检查键值是否指向正确的文件路径。若发现异常,可借助官方修复工具重建注册表关联。
其他程序进程的干扰某些安全软件或系统优化工具会主动拦截Excel的加载项调用过程。特别是具有行为监控功能的防护程序,可能将加载项的操作误判为可疑活动。临时禁用实时保护功能进行测试,可帮助定位问题来源。此外,同时运行的办公类软件也可能产生资源冲突,建议关闭其他应用程序后重新启动Excel观察效果。
加载项文件本身的完整性文件下载不完整或存储介质错误都可能导致加载项文件损坏。表现为文件大小异常或数字签名验证失败。可通过哈希值校验工具对比官方提供的校验和,确认文件完整性。对于压缩包形式的加载项,解压时需注意是否报错。网络传输过程中若中断重试,建议清除浏览器缓存后重新下载。
用户配置文件异常Excel在启动时会加载当前用户的个性化配置,当这些配置文件损坏时,可能影响加载项的正常初始化。症状包括加载项列表显示异常或设置无法保存。可尝试创建新的Windows用户账户测试,若问题消失则说明原配置文件存在问题。通过控制面板中的邮件设置功能重建配置文件,可修复此类软性故障。
系统更新引发的兼容变化Windows系统或Office套件的定期更新可能改变底层运行环境,导致原本正常的加载项突然失效。这种情况在重大版本更新后尤为明显。查看更新历史记录中的安装时间,与问题出现时间进行比对。可通过系统还原功能回退到更新前状态验证,但需注意此操作可能影响其他软件的正常使用。
依赖组件缺失问题复杂加载项往往依赖额外的运行库或框架支持,如特定版本的组件对象模型或.NET框架。当这些依赖项未安装或版本不匹配时,加载过程会 silently fail。查看系统事件查看器中的应用程序日志,通常能找到相关错误信息。根据提示安装对应的可再发行组件包,多数情况下能恢复功能。
多语言环境设置冲突区域和语言设置差异可能导致加载项识别错误。例如为英文系统开发的加载项,在中文系统下可能因路径中的特殊字符而加载失败。检查控制面板中的区域设置,确保非Unicode程序的语言与系统一致。对于企业级部署的加载项,还需确认组策略中的语言配置策略未产生冲突。
加载项初始化超时机制Excel为防止单个加载项影响启动性能,设置了默认加载超时时间。当加载项初始化过程超过限定时长,系统会自动跳过该加载项。这种情况常见于需要连接网络资源或执行复杂计算的加载项。可通过修改注册表适当延长超时阈值,但需权衡启动速度与功能完整性之间的平衡。
冲突加载项的相互排斥安装多个功能相似的加载项时,可能因资源争用或函数重定义导致冲突。表现为部分加载项随机失效或功能异常。采用逐一禁用排查法,每次只保留一个加载项进行测试,可准确定位冲突来源。某些专业加载项会在文档中明确列出兼容性说明,安装前应仔细阅读相关要求。
宏设置与加载项的关联影响虽然宏与加载项属于不同概念,但基于宏的加载项受宏安全性控制。当全局宏设置处于"禁用所有宏"状态时,此类加载项将无法运行。需根据使用场景选择"禁用所有宏并发出通知"或"启用所有宏"选项。对于重要工作环境,建议通过数字签名方式为宏加载项添加可信标识。
用户账户控制级别的限制系统用户账户控制设置过高时,会阻止加载项对系统资源的正常访问。尤其当加载项需要修改注册表或写入系统目录时,可能因权限不足而失败。临时降低控制级别测试后,如能正常加载,则说明需要调整安装方式或联系开发者提供标准安装程序。
模板文件对加载项的调用关系Excel启动时会自动加载个人模板文件,若模板中引用了特定加载项,但该加载项未安装则会导致错误。检查启动文件夹中的模板文件,清除不必要的加载项引用。同时注意正常模板与加载项模板的区别,避免将两类文件混放在同一目录。
系统架构匹配的重要性64位系统上运行的Excel程序无法直接使用32位编译的加载项,反之亦然。表现为加载项列表可见但功能无效。通过任务管理器查看Excel进程的后缀标识,确认位宽匹配情况。混合环境部署时,需准备不同架构的加载项版本,或统一使用兼容模式运行。
加载项缓存机制异常Excel会缓存已加载的组件信息以提升性能,但当缓存数据损坏时反而会导致加载失败。可手动清除位于应用程序数据文件夹下的缓存目录,强制Excel重新生成加载信息。注意此操作会同时清除其他自定义设置,建议提前备份重要配置。
165人看过
352人看过
263人看过
241人看过
277人看过
153人看过
.webp)
.webp)

.webp)
.webp)
.webp)